Muse Alexa Voice Car Assistant

This in-car accessory lets you switch on your lights or the heater using voice commands. You can also ask Alexa for traffic updates and take handsfree calls.

Kuri Adorable Home Robot

This cute little robot can record everyday family highlights, play music on demand and respond to your voice.

Aura Connected Alarm Clock by Withings

Using light and sound, this smart clock can help you wind down at night and wake up refreshed in the morning.

The Eight Smart Mattress

Made from memory foam, this smart mattress connects to your phone so you can request the perfect sleeping temperature.

D-Link Omna 180 Cam HD Security Camera

With a 180º wide-angle lens and night vision technology, the WiFi-connected Omna camera lets you keep watch over your home from anywhere in the world.

CUJO Smart Home Firewall Device

By setting up a personal firewall, CUJO protects all your devices from online threats. It also offers neat parental controls.

DJI Spark Mini Drone

This compact quadcopter lets you capture your adventures from above. You can set the drone to track you, or control the Spark with gestures.

Belkin BOOST UP Wireless iPhone Charging Pad

Sick of tripping over wires? This Belkin charging pad offers tangle-free power for your iPhone 8, iPhone 8 Plus, and the iPhone X.

Mues Tec Smart Mirror Touchscreen

This handsome mirror lets you play songs and check the weather at the start of each day. Thanks to the built-in camera, it also works as a smart body analyzer.

Otto Smart Digital Door Lock

Using proximity for security, this smart door lock opens with a single touch when you arrive home.
